‘Earthlings’ (2003) is a feature length documentary about humanity’s absolute dependence on animals (for pets, food, clothing, entertainment, and… all scientific research) but also illustrates our complete disrespect for these so-called “non-human providers.” The film is narrated by Academy Award nominee Joaquin Phoenix and features music by the critically acclaimed platinum artist Moby.
